When exploring portable water chillers, it’s essential to grasp their fundamental mechanics. These units typically operate using refrigeration cycles, much like traditional chillers. They withdraw heat from the water, effectively lowering its temperature. According to a recent industry report, portable water chillers can reduce water temperature by up to 10°C in a matter of minutes, which is crucial for various applications like data centers or events.
Different types of portable chillers cater to diverse needs. For example, air-cooled chillers are generally easier to install. They rely on ambient air to dissipate heat. In contrast, water-cooled models are often more efficient but demand more space and proper water supply. Research indicates that efficiency can vary dramatically; some units may achieve up to 17% greater energy efficiency when compared to their counterparts.
Choosing the right model involves balancing capacity, efficiency, and specific application requirements. It's common to overlook noise levels, yet they can impact comfort in environments. Users should evaluate noise ratings during decision-making. As noted in an equipment review, a quieter model might be worth the investment, especially in residential settings. When choosing a portable water chiller, several factors are crucial. Start with the cooling capacity. This affects how quickly the unit can lower water temperature. Assess your specific cooling needs based on usage. For example, a larger capacity is better for commercial settings.
Tip: Look for units with adjustable cooling settings. This ensures you can customize the temperature based on your needs.
Next, consider the energy efficiency. A more efficient model can significantly reduce your energy bills over time. Evaluate the energy ratings and choose a model that balances performance with cost savings.
Tip: Read user reviews to gain insights on long-term performance and reliability.
Portability is essential. Ensure the unit has sturdy wheels and a lightweight design if you plan to move it often. Check dimensions to ensure it fits your available space. Design flaws in some models can impact usability.
